在当今的Web开发领域,组件化设计已成为提升开发效率和质量的关键。component注册组件,作为组件化开发的核心环节,直接影响着项目的稳定性和可维护性。**将围绕component注册组件这一问题,深入探讨其重要性、方法及注意事项,帮助开发者更好地理解和应用这一技术。
一、component注册组件的重要性
1.1提高代码复用性
通过注册组件,可以将常用的功能封装成独立的模块,便于在不同页面或项目中复用,减少代码冗余。
1.2降低耦合度
组件化开发有助于降低组件之间的耦合度,使项目结构更加清晰,便于维护和扩展。
1.3提升开发效率
注册组件可以快速构建项目,提高开发效率,降低开发成本。
二、component注册组件的方法
2.1使用Vue.js注册组件
2.1.1全局注册
在Vue实例创建之前,使用Vue.use()方法全局注册组件。
Vue.use(MyComponent)2.1.2局部注册
在组件内部,使用components选项注册组件。
exportdefault{components:{
MyComponent
2.2使用React注册组件
2.2.1创建组件
使用ES6的class语法或函数式组件创建React组件。
classMyComponentextendsReact.Component{functionMyComponent(props){
2.2.2在父组件中使用
在父组件中,通过import引入子组件,并在JSX中直接使用。
importMyComponentfrom'./MyComponent'functionApp(){
return(
三、component注册组件的注意事项
3.1组件命名规范
遵循驼峰命名法,确保组件名称清晰易懂。
3.2组件职责单一
每个组件应专注于实现单一功能,避免功能过于复杂。
3.3组件通信
合理设计组件间的通信方式,如props、事件、Vuex等。
3.4组件状态管理
对于复杂组件,考虑使用Vuex等状态管理库进行状态管理。
四、
component注册组件是组件化开发的核心环节,对项目的稳定性和可维护性具有重要意义。通过**的介绍,相信读者对component注册组件有了更深入的了解。在实际开发过程中,遵循相关规范,合理注册组件,将有助于提升开发效率和质量。